Delanie and I began our search for web fonts today and settled on Modak for the headings and Istok Web for the body copy. We also picked a warm color palette with earthy tones. However, after receiving feedback we decided to change our header font to one called "Spicy Rice" because it was easier to read. Due to our limit of 3 graphics for the page, we utilized borders and color variation to make the content more interesting.

After completing the lowercase set of characters for my font, I started putting them into the Fontself Maker extension, and mapping them out. Some turned out well, and others did not. It became clear to me which letters needed to be revised after seeing them at such a small scale.

This week I decided on a typeface to further develop, and planned out the rest of the characters in it. The one I picked was inspired by architectural drawings and has a sketchy, angular appearance to it. In order to vectorize my font and put it into the template, I first had to adjust the levels in Photoshop to make it darker. Then I used Illustrator to trace the image and smooth out the curves.
